Typical Sources of Air Leaks in Feature
Determining typical resources of air leakages is vital for boosting a home's power performance. These leaks typically happen in numerous locations of a structure, significantly impacting heating & cooling expenses. Common wrongdoers include gaps around home windows and doors, where seals may wear away with time. Additionally, electrical outlets and switches can produce pathways for air exchange otherwise properly insulated. Cellars and attic rooms are additionally frequent resources, specifically where walls fulfill the structure or the roofing system. Various other potential leak factors consist of pipes penetrations, venting systems, and the areas surrounding smokeshafts. In addition, older residential properties may experience deteriorated structure products, raising vulnerability to air seepage. By acknowledging these typical resources, residential property proprietors can take positive actions to secure leakages, therefore improving general energy efficiency and comfort within their areas. Dealing with these problems is a crucial component of establishing an airtight solution for any type of building.
Approaches of Power Screening: Blower Door and Thermal Imaging
Reliable power screening approaches, such as blower door examinations and thermal imaging, play a crucial role in identifying air leaks within a building. The blower door examination entails depressurizing a building or pressurizing to measure air movement and recognize leakages. A calibrated follower is set up in an exterior doorway, and the resulting pressure distinction highlights areas of undesirable air seepage. This approach evaluates the total airtightness of the structure.Thermal imaging matches blower door tests by visually finding temperature level variations on surface areas, disclosing concealed air leakages. Infrared cams catch heat loss or gain, enabling accurate identification of problem locations, such as improperly insulated walls or voids around home windows and doors. energy testing south carolina. Together, these approaches provide a thorough analysis of a residential property's energy performance, enabling homeowner to address air leakages efficiently and improve total efficiency
